Donald Trump Shuns Press Conference, Celebrates Successful Foreign Trip with American Troops
(NAVAL AIR STATION SIGONELLA, Sicily) — President Donald Trump on Saturday said his maiden first trip abroad was a "home run" and he vowed to overcome the threat of terrorism, concluding a grueling five-stop sprint that ended with the promise of an imminent decision on the much-discussed Paris climate accord.
Trump ended his nine-day trip with a speech to U.S. troops in Sicily, where he recounted his visits to Saudi Arabia, Israel, Belgium and Italy and his work to counter terrorism. The president said recent terrorist attacks in Manchester, England and Egypt underscored the need for the U.S. to "defeat terrorism and protect civilization."
"Terrorism is a threat, bad threat to all of humanity," Trump said, standing in front of a massive American flag at Naval Air Station Sigonella. "And together we will overcome this threat. We will win."
The president recalled the terrorist attacks in Manchester and Egypt that targeted innocent women and children as well as a suicide bombing in Indonesia that killed three police officers. He said that attacks would only steel the resolve of world leaders to fight terrorism.
“Together, civilized nations will crush the terrorists, block their funding, strip them of their territory, and drive them out of this earth,” Trump said.
The president arrived on the base to a raucous crowd and shouts of “USA! USA! USA!” as the Air Force One movie soundtrack played in the background.
First lady Melania Trump introduced her husband, calling the journey an “incredible trip.”
“My husband worked very hard on behalf of our country, and I’m very proud of him,” she said.
Trump recalled his commitment to a “peace through strength” foreign policy.
“That’s what we’re gonna have. We’re gonna have a lot of strength and a lot of peace,” he said.
The president and the first lady return to Washington, DC, Saturday evening, as they plan to recognize Memorial Day on Monday.
